Abbie Liechty (Henry County Attorney, Iowa, candidate 2026)
Abbie Liechty ran in a special election to the Henry County Attorney in Iowa. Liechty was on the ballot in the special general election on March 31, 2026.

Special general election for Henry County Attorney
Abbie Liechty (Nonpartisan) and Becky Wilson (Nonpartisan) ran in the special general election for Henry County Attorney on March 31, 2026.
